Licensing and Regulation: Ensuring a Safe Betting Environment 

A horse racing bettor should prioritize the use of a safe and secure site that is licensed and regulated by top betting watchdogs like the Malta Gaming Authority and the UK Gambling Commission. 

Why should you not ignore this aspect? Licensed sites follow fair and transparent policies that make your betting experience secure and legitimate. 

If you are probably wondering how you can recognize licensed and regulated horse racing betting sites, consider some of these tips: 

  • Check out for positive and negative feedback.
  • Explore user reviews on the site.
  • Confirm that a site complies with licensing and regulatory authorities. 
  • Interact with other bettors on online forums to draw information from firsthand user experiences. 

Betting Markets and Odds: Maximizing Your Wagering Options 

Have you ever wondered about the layout of horse racing markets and odds? Just like other sports, there is an array of markets and odds, distinct for horse racing betting. The most common markets include Place (winner), Exacta, Each Way, Trifecta, Quinella, Duet, First 4, Quaddie, Daily Double, and Parlay Formula. 

Odds combinations are a fun and interesting way of generating competitive odds that maximize your wager, giving you better potential returns.

Promotions and Bonuses: Evaluating the Real Value 

Promotions and bonuses add value to your horse racing betting experience by giving you an extra cushion when placing bets. If you can access different types of bonuses, such as deposit bonuses, sign-up bonuses, and free bets, wagering becomes even more enjoyable. They minimize the risk of using your own money to bet. 

However, it is advisable to ensure that you perform due diligence by reading and understanding the terms and conditions tied to any promotion or bonus that you can access. There is also a need to familiarize yourself with the wagering requirements and expiration dates of bonuses.

Consider the expiration dates and the wagering requirements that need to be fulfilled when accessing bonuses. 

Payment Methods and Transaction Security: Managing Your Funds Safely 

Payment methods are key in betting, which is not unique to horse racing betting. Therefore, prioritize sites that allow different payment methods, such as credit and debit cards, bank transfers, e-wallets, and cryptocurrency.

When making your payment through your preferred option, it is advisable to use sites with minimal transaction fees and no hidden costs. 

Additionally, countercheck the processing time for deposits and withdrawals to avoid inconveniences or delays, which could hugely impact your betting experience. 

Another important factor to prioritize is the security measures that a betting site has put in place.  

For instance, cryptocurrencies are highly recognized for being secure and transparent; hence, there are minimal risks involved. Betting sites that incorporate encryption in their payment methods are worth consideration.
